Importance of a European business banking account
European startups face a unique challenge: operating across multiple jurisdictions with different banking requirements, currencies, and regulations. A Berlin-based AI startup might need to process payments from London clients, pay contractors in Amsterdam, and manage investors from Paris – all while maintaining compliance with varying financial regulations.
Traditional banks weren’t designed for this reality. For fast-moving tech companies, banking friction can mean the difference between seizing market opportunities and watching competitors gain the advantage. A dedicated European business banking account serves as the foundation for professional financial management, enabling companies to handle transactions efficiently while maintaining clear separation between personal and business finances.
Benefits of opening a business banking account in Europe
Operating with a European IBAN provides numerous advantages that extend far beyond basic transaction capabilities. For tech startups, these benefits become particularly compelling:
- Cost efficiency: Euro business banking account holders avoid expensive international transfer fees and unfavorable exchange rates when conducting business within the Eurozone. This financial efficiency becomes crucial for companies managing regular payments to European suppliers or receiving payments from European customers.
- Trust and credibility: Having a local European account builds trust with clients, suppliers, and partners who prefer working with businesses that demonstrate commitment to the region through established banking relationships.
- Multi-currency support: A well-designed fintech business account typically supports multiple currencies, allowing companies to hold, exchange, and transfer funds in various denominations without the complications associated with traditional banking systems.
- Real-time access: Online business banking platforms in Europe offer 24/7 access to account management tools, real-time transaction monitoring, and detailed financial reporting. These features enable business owners to maintain tight control over their finances while accessing comprehensive data for informed decision-making.

Step-by-step guide to opening an account
The process of opening business account online in Europe through Satchel follows a logical progression designed to minimize delays and confusion:
- Initial application: Businesses provide basic company information including registration details, business activities, and expected transaction volumes.
- Documentation submission: Requirements include standard business registration certificates, proof of address, and identification for authorized signatories. The platform guides applicants through each requirement, specifying exactly what documents are needed and in what format.
- Identity verification: This occurs through secure online processes, eliminating the need for in-person meetings or notarized documents. This step typically completes within 24-48 hours, depending on the complexity of the business structure and the completeness of submitted documentation.
- Account activation: Following successful verification, businesses receive their European IBAN details and access to online banking platforms. The entire process, from initial application to active account status, typically completes within 3-5 business days.
